Oatmeal Chocolate Chip Cookies

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up softened butter
  • 1/4 cup shortening
  • 1 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/2 cup white sugar
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p baking soda
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1 cup whole wheat flour
  • 3/4 cup white flour
  • 2 cups rolled oats
  • 1 1/2 cups chocolate chips

Directions

  1. In large mixing bowl, cream together butter and shortening on medium speed for about 30 seconds
  2. Add brown sugar and white sugar, mix well
  3. Add baking powder, baking soda, and cinnamon, mix well
  4. Beat in eggs, one at a time
  5. Add vanilla, mix well
  6. Add flour, mix until well combined
  7. Stir in rolled oats with spoon
  8. Add chocolate chips and stir to combine
  9. Drop rounded teaspoons of dough onto parchment paper lined cookie sheet
  10. Bake at 365 degrees for 8-9 minutes
  11. Cool on wire racks and store in airtight containers
